diff options
author | Robin H. Johnson <robbat2@gentoo.org> | 2010-03-25 19:28:47 +0000 |
---|---|---|
committer | Robin H. Johnson <robbat2@gentoo.org> | 2010-03-25 19:28:47 +0000 |
commit | b3ab46d8a262f7e7afa3d68d5280351e8b880139 (patch) | |
tree | 592dd6a927ac2bc26974585585a8ba1d613a4cb1 /net-misc/adjtimex | |
parent | Set SUPPORT_PYTHON_ABIS. (diff) | |
download | historical-b3ab46d8a262f7e7afa3d68d5280351e8b880139.tar.gz historical-b3ab46d8a262f7e7afa3d68d5280351e8b880139.tar.bz2 historical-b3ab46d8a262f7e7afa3d68d5280351e8b880139.zip |
Straight bump to fix bug in init.d script of /usr/bin call without 'need localmount', so startup failed sometimes.
Package-Manager: portage-2.2_rc67/cvs/Linux x86_64
RepoMan-Options: --force
Diffstat (limited to 'net-misc/adjtimex')
-rw-r--r-- | net-misc/adjtimex/ChangeLog | 11 | ||||
-rw-r--r-- | net-misc/adjtimex/Manifest | 5 | ||||
-rw-r--r-- | net-misc/adjtimex/adjtimex-1.20-r3.ebuild | 51 | ||||
-rw-r--r-- | net-misc/adjtimex/files/adjtimex.init | 3 |
4 files changed, 65 insertions, 5 deletions
diff --git a/net-misc/adjtimex/ChangeLog b/net-misc/adjtimex/ChangeLog index 94e4419e582e..6de78ae0a3d8 100644 --- a/net-misc/adjtimex/ChangeLog +++ b/net-misc/adjtimex/ChangeLog @@ -1,6 +1,13 @@ # ChangeLog for net-misc/adjtimex -# Copyright 1999-2009 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/net-misc/adjtimex/ChangeLog,v 1.22 2009/09/23 19:32:56 patrick Exp $ +#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/net-misc/adjtimex/ChangeLog,v 1.23 2010/03/25 19:28:46 robbat2 Exp $ + +*adjtimex-1.20-r3 (25 Mar 2010) + + 25 Mar 2010; Robin H. Johnson <robbat2@gentoo.org> + +adjtimex-1.20-r3.ebuild, files/adjtimex.init: + Straight bump to fix bug in init.d script of /usr/bin call without 'need + localmount', so startup failed sometimes. 23 Sep 2009; Patrick Lauer <patrick@gentoo.org> adjtimex-1.16.ebuild, adjtimex-1.16-r1.ebuild, adjtimex-1.20.ebuild, adjtimex-1.20-r1.ebuild, diff --git a/net-misc/adjtimex/Manifest b/net-misc/adjtimex/Manifest index 36467159201c..b2b0bebe568c 100644 --- a/net-misc/adjtimex/Manifest +++ b/net-misc/adjtimex/Manifest @@ -1,7 +1,7 @@ AUX adjtimex-1.16-pic.patch 315 RMD160 f1554dc83ff26b3c667a2a71e13b17d30485f019 SHA1 38e6eba7802486e482bac63b388bf8ff7d220958 SHA256 1dd729984de9852e3a2ac6f7a525cfb4a1c101c07b736fbf8e3a8ffa8d5c793c AUX adjtimex-1.20-fix-syscall.patch 404 RMD160 1d43ea4b75ed71e921399c9ad9a3e5e117098249 SHA1 e6a0025619a4494ec87c0cfe535c6abd20784aa0 SHA256 87911a16bd1762a914157f1637294753407b171e132948798ebb5f8a8b7792c0 AUX adjtimex-1.20-gentoo-utc.patch 820 RMD160 be3e47073c19ece3a497cc0619842ceda2d5ad79 SHA1 d6a1092cd649fd66d0ca70ab240b543a1455b0a5 SHA256 eb9ab65184e5e7d450968651f76169321b841e1e95bef9211a575b9c5978df2d -AUX adjtimex.init 733 RMD160 e1bbc62ebef78972cabbb767906abd44b9e39a35 SHA1 c96bce95c5073872b859f0e8623f274b9891000f SHA256 588235997e178a63aca1eb1a57e74a6e8d29a0bb68f2d0bf00d7ec61f3f299a8 +AUX adjtimex.init 750 RMD160 3883cef965d7af1bfe11fffd239c942f848d42fb SHA1 b2f2c079599fe406a377c72373a42f1ef97ebe6f SHA256 e686d4d2450b71f5d9a16b3a11ea5a39e202e45a475373abea9804082b75e793 DIST adjtimex_1.16-1.diff.gz 31236 RMD160 2322f382c7560fd0337d451acf3da5b57309896e SHA1 e2986afaa0eafc7e73da0752f4440ddead175888 SHA256 026554c0a1baecb993f9ff8b8e4667fb076e84b34ed2218afc65e7dca4552a90 DIST adjtimex_1.16.orig.tar.gz 66783 RMD160 dfb21f3c862bce3357815cc36ce9b127904aded4 SHA1 8bc9e486cc40a445b0c88fcb1f10d6e10ccda08d SHA256 12693b97098e138370424b09428ebe86ba7fb839f8839f69c25f3e7a1cb4b23f DIST adjtimex_1.20-3.diff.gz 37171 RMD160 9b680241a05770bb80be63a4691b2f4af320494c SHA1 f60ddba8eb7fc4f012c4c9e36300dac104e26ab3 SHA256 6ac20d5508170a41d1eb7664810649d23b0a216c9d26173188d6d3ec089f9de8 @@ -11,6 +11,7 @@ EBUILD adjtimex-1.16-r1.ebuild 1379 RMD160 3d631b3ce1bd13e59f4068cedd1cfd5b32b7d EBUILD adjtimex-1.16.ebuild 1174 RMD160 143f3c3410b4a02219355f6cc0b928d3cadedb29 SHA1 9b5da26a4ca97a37e9a72eab12ca74e830353f18 SHA256 f9c9eca60522ee4e7084026856cc71ed5517fed0068570ec511195b78b4da41f EBUILD adjtimex-1.20-r1.ebuild 1448 RMD160 e05138d92a588e6fd1c768a2070a4545953627e2 SHA1 c3882369bea47cb0c4546cad51a52c534adb2f77 SHA256 efc7b3de01a973a0ec96578ecf59954da98babf2b09d48f281dcef73d9325ef2 EBUILD adjtimex-1.20-r2.ebuild 1493 RMD160 348a0c0c6cb2b843d991fff7142880988e6d3d23 SHA1 42a89c984dd30b71ffea09e88438c580d7cb2189 SHA256 8b4e5bc2cc9f883d4f20b5bfa4e58fd57821a8ccae0db173997d74ae707c216f +EBUILD adjtimex-1.20-r3.ebuild 1493 RMD160 781822e528b18ae890b19367a216e4a78e7f39ef SHA1 dcf2bbe8c9758995e58b33ac2c22c4b9e10a1861 SHA256 a3a6533b3b9ef73488a014861c0590f75d16b28f6d205fc314d5a0e75e6b4fc2 EBUILD adjtimex-1.20.ebuild 1377 RMD160 65f3f2a4b73992eeff19f45803e30de3bf576c30 SHA1 e6a2aba4b529a88b299e2477a8b0d89335a10bdc SHA256 05f811b296706843273d442b82ca1f4983b564fafa05e16a003454b87096440c -MISC ChangeLog 3096 RMD160 b605293a427ee206e1e408a9609bc8faeec21b84 SHA1 128cab51bf332cf6588cf624c8a9a63393a709d4 SHA256 057945a3ebe70c29949a622a94e34ce60171d79436444191e0afe7e3aaaf5794 +MISC ChangeLog 3351 RMD160 00f25e5b87d06cf3a79a1b08d85cf2193fc84db2 SHA1 6799a8dac89a611780daf692048d69e032d38d99 SHA256 9186e6f2ad5ad545976443be6ab128b593232700b6015b6631a06613c1c64a14 MISC metadata.xml 223 RMD160 ffa99612cf27469c417944deed0e0c9155e64331 SHA1 607c637402dd253406aa6ee684471a702c5d1a99 SHA256 d6bb9ba68629616062b4433ab3b8fb01dfcafae5bb47804d9e06cdd6c66daa44 diff --git a/net-misc/adjtimex/adjtimex-1.20-r3.ebuild b/net-misc/adjtimex/adjtimex-1.20-r3.ebuild new file mode 100644 index 000000000000..cc5afc54e036 --- /dev/null +++ b/net-misc/adjtimex/adjtimex-1.20-r3.ebuild @@ -0,0 +1,51 @@ +# Copyright 1999-2010 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/net-misc/adjtimex/adjtimex-1.20-r3.ebuild,v 1.1 2010/03/25 19:28:46 robbat2 Exp $ + +inherit fixheadtails eutils + +DEBIAN_PV="6" +MY_P="${P/-/_}" +DEBIAN_URI="mirror://debian/pool/main/${PN:0:1}/${PN}" +DEBIAN_PATCH="${MY_P}-${DEBIAN_PV}.diff.gz" +DEBIAN_SRC="${MY_P}.orig.tar.gz" +DESCRIPTION="display or set the kernel time variables" +HOMEPAGE="http://www.ibiblio.org/linsearch/lsms/adjtimex.html" +SRC_URI="${DEBIAN_URI}/${DEBIAN_PATCH} + ${DEBIAN_URI}/${DEBIAN_SRC}" + +LICENSE="GPL-2" +SLOT="0" +KEYWORDS="alpha amd64 ppc x86" +IUSE="" + +RDEPEND="" +DEPEND="${RDEPEND} sys-apps/sed" + +src_unpack() { + unpack ${DEBIAN_SRC} + epatch ${DISTDIR}/${DEBIAN_PATCH} + cd ${S} + for i in debian/adjtimexconfig debian/adjtimexconfig.8 ; do + sed -e 's|/etc/default/adjtimex|/etc/conf.d/adjtimex|' \ + -i.orig ${i} + sed -e 's|^/sbin/adjtimex |/usr/sbin/adjtimex |' \ + -i.orig ${i} + done + epatch ${FILESDIR}/${PN}-1.20-gentoo-utc.patch + ht_fix_file debian/adjtimexconfig + sed -e '/CFLAGS = -Wall -t/,/endif/d' -i Makefile.in + epatch ${FILESDIR}/${PN}-1.16-pic.patch + epatch ${FILESDIR}/${PN}-1.20-fix-syscall.patch +} + +src_install() { + dodoc README* ChangeLog + doman adjtimex.8 debian/adjtimexconfig.8 + dosbin adjtimex debian/adjtimexconfig + newinitd ${FILESDIR}/adjtimex.init adjtimex +} + +pkg_postinst() { + einfo "Please run adjtimexconfig to create the configuration file" +} diff --git a/net-misc/adjtimex/files/adjtimex.init b/net-misc/adjtimex/files/adjtimex.init index 50c90a53eda3..fd99138e962a 100644 --- a/net-misc/adjtimex/files/adjtimex.init +++ b/net-misc/adjtimex/files/adjtimex.init @@ -1,7 +1,7 @@ #!/sbin/runscript # Copyright 1999-2004 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/net-misc/adjtimex/files/adjtimex.init,v 1.4 2008/09/14 05:03:59 robbat2 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-misc/adjtimex/files/adjtimex.init,v 1.5 2010/03/25 19:28:47 robbat2 Exp $ DAEMON=adjtimex OPTS="--tick ${TICK} --frequency ${FREQ}" @@ -9,6 +9,7 @@ CONFD="/etc/conf.d/${DAEMON}" depend() { before ntp-client ntpd + need localmount } checkconfig() { |